Recommended Menu Items at Hisago Washoku

We arrived at around 1:00 p.m.
Seafood rice bowls, sushi set meals,
conger eel, kuruma-prawns, horse mackerel, fried oysters…
The menu options begin right at the entrance, and honestly, choosing was a delightful struggle!

Should we go for sushi?

Or maybe order an Γ la carte item for the little one?

In the end, we ordered the Sea Bream Ara-daki Set Meal (simmered sea bream collar) for 1,848 yen, and…

…the Kagoshima Kurobuta Pork Loin Cutlet Set Meal (with sashimi) for 1,848 yen.
Both dishes were absolutely HUGE!!
(So glad we didn’t add any Γ la carte items, lol!)

The moment they arrived at our table, I gasped “Whoaaa!” and the staff cheerfully replied, “Yes, we’re known for our hearty portions!” π

The sashimi was wonderful, of course, and the ara-daki (simmered sea bream collar) was absolutely incredible β
the vegetables were perfectly soaked in flavor too.
By the way, rice refills are free!
Personally, I found the pickles so delicious that I had to be careful not to overeat.
The miso soup featured seasonal aosa seaweed.
With those pickles and miso soup alone, you could easily put away two bowls of rice.

The tonkatsu (pork cutlet) was equally outstanding.
It was tender, with a perfectly thin and crispy coating β absolutely delicious πβ
My daughter devoured it!

My daughter snatched it up so quickly I couldn’t even get a picture, but the chawanmushi (savory egg custard) came with gyuhi (soft mochi) and shiratama dango (rice flour dumplings) inside!

The spaghetti was tossed with egg β a delightful little surprise.
These two set meals were enough to feed two adults plus a toddler β for both lunch AND dinner! (Seriously!)
At first glance, the prices might seem a bit steep, but when you factor in the volume and quality, it’s actually fantastic value.
